《代码中的软件工程》学习总结/心得体会

1. 高效的开发工具是我们学习过程中的好帮手,课程中教我们使用的vscode正是这样一款软件。老师课堂上教的一些快捷使用方式,更是进一步提高了vscode的效率。

2. github是我们广泛使用的开源项目仓库,课程上介绍了git的使用方法。从clone、add、push、rebase到merge等等。学习使用git在今后的学习和工作中都将会有很大的助益。

3. 课堂中系统地学习了需求分析、用例建模的方式方法。帮助我们能够更好地从甲方的需求出发一步步构建出我们所需要的系统。

4. 课堂上还学习了敏捷开发等现在广泛应用的开发方式,让我们了解了增量迭代的思想。

5. 关于menu的代码实操给了我们很多设计模式和设计方法上的启发,通过代码的一次次迭代过程让在校的我们真正认识到并初步理解了工程代码的书写方式和迭代方式。

6. 在软件科学基础概论部分,我们学习了软件的组成部分、软件的基本结构以及设计模式、面向对象概念和编程中的一些特殊机制,如回调函数、闭包、匿名函数等,加深了我们对高质量代码的认识。

7. 老师详细介绍了软件危机的产生原因和过程。在这一章节我们系统地学习了TSP、CMMI、敏捷方法和DevOps等软件开发和评估方法,对我们今后提升软件质量有很大助益。

总而言之,通过一个学期的理论学习和实际代码编写,我们学会了软件开发过程中常用工具的使用方法和其进阶玩法。对于软件开发我们掌握了从需求分析、用例提取、软件初步和详细设计、软件开发方法、软件开发过程、软件开发质量、软件测试这样一个全流程的方法。在今后的工作当中要进步加强对这些理论知识的认识,也要加强对这些知识的应用。将高质量代码的要求贯彻到日常学习和工作中去。
 

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 1
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论 1
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值